How can farmers minimize the negative effects of tilling on soil?

Farmers can minimize the negative effects of tilling on soil by adopting conservation tillage techniques, such as no-till or reduced-till practices, which help preserve soil structure, enhance organic matter, and reduce erosion. These methods are crucial for sustainable agriculture, ensuring that soil health is maintained while crop yields remain robust.

What Are the Negative Effects of Tilling?

Tilling, while beneficial for preparing seedbeds and controlling weeds, can have several adverse effects on soil health:

  • Soil Erosion: Tilling disrupts soil structure, making it more susceptible to erosion by wind and water.
  • Loss of Organic Matter: Continuous tilling can lead to the decomposition of organic matter, reducing soil fertility.
  • Soil Compaction: Over time, tilling can compact the soil, limiting root growth and water infiltration.
  • Disruption of Soil Microorganisms: Frequent tilling disturbs soil ecosystems, affecting beneficial microorganisms.

How Can Farmers Minimize Tilling’s Impact on Soil?

Farmers can adopt several practices to mitigate the negative effects of tilling:

1. Implementing No-Till Farming

No-till farming involves planting crops without disturbing the soil through tillage. This method helps maintain soil structure and increases water retention.

  • Benefits:
    • Reduces soil erosion
    • Enhances organic matter retention
    • Improves soil moisture levels

2. Using Cover Crops

Planting cover crops, such as clover or rye, can protect the soil surface and enhance soil quality. These crops prevent erosion, add organic matter, and improve soil structure.

  • Advantages:
    • Suppress weeds naturally
    • Enhance soil fertility
    • Provide habitat for beneficial insects

3. Practicing Crop Rotation

Crop rotation involves alternating the types of crops grown on a particular piece of land. This practice can break pest and disease cycles and improve soil health.

  • Benefits:
    • Reduces pest buildup
    • Enhances nutrient cycling
    • Improves soil structure

4. Adopting Reduced-Till Techniques

Reduced-till farming minimizes soil disturbance compared to conventional tilling. This method involves shallow tillage that maintains soil integrity.

  • Advantages:
    • Decreases soil compaction
    • Preserves soil moisture
    • Maintains organic matter levels

Practical Examples and Case Studies

Example: Successful No-Till Farming in Iowa

In Iowa, many farmers have transitioned to no-till farming with impressive results. By avoiding traditional tillage, they have seen improvements in soil structure and moisture retention, leading to increased crop yields and reduced input costs.

Case Study: Cover Crops in Pennsylvania

A Pennsylvania farmer incorporated cover crops into their rotation, resulting in a 30% reduction in soil erosion and a noticeable improvement in soil organic matter. This practice also led to decreased reliance on chemical fertilizers.

How Does Tilling Affect Soil Fertility?

Tilling can reduce soil fertility by accelerating the breakdown of organic matter, which is essential for nutrient availability. Over time, this can lead to nutrient depletion and the need for increased fertilizer use.

Is No-Till Farming Cost-Effective?

Yes, no-till farming can be cost-effective. It reduces fuel and labor costs associated with traditional tillage and can lead to higher yields due to improved soil health and moisture retention.

What Are the Environmental Benefits of Reduced Tillage?

Reduced tillage helps minimize soil erosion, enhances water retention, and promotes biodiversity by preserving soil ecosystems. This contributes to a more sustainable agricultural system.

Can Cover Crops Replace Fertilizers?

While cover crops cannot entirely replace fertilizers, they significantly reduce the need for synthetic inputs by naturally enhancing soil fertility and structure. They fix nitrogen and add organic matter to the soil.

How Does Crop Rotation Improve Soil Health?

Crop rotation improves soil health by diversifying the plant species grown, which reduces pest and disease pressure and enhances nutrient cycling. This practice helps maintain a balanced soil ecosystem.
